Formation of the Prussian Confederation
The Prussian Confederation was established by a coalition of cities and nobles in Prussia, aiming to protect their interests against the Teutonic Order. This coalition emerged as a response to the increasing power and territorial ambitions of the Order. The cities of Danzig (Gdańsk), Thorn (Toruń), and several others united to oppose the dominance of the Teutonic Knights. This unification marked a significant turning point in Prussian governance and laid the groundwork for future regional independence.

Maria of Enghien sold the lordship of Argos and Nauplia to the Republic of Venice. This transaction occurred due to the need for financial resources and was finalized in a strategic move that would enhance Venetian influence in the region. Nauplia and Argos were significant urban centers in the Peloponnese, featuring commerce and military importance. The sale marked a shift in power dynamics between local rulers and international powers like Venice.
